@All
Seems in x5000 distrib there is mistake, and libpng12.so just named as it, but in reality its libpng16.so (check inside of library on version, or even compare size of libpng12.so and libpng16.so). So you need real libpng12.so, which you can take or from os4.1_update2 for example. I also upload it there: http://kas1e.mikendezign.com/aos4/cyrus/libpng12.so

So now blender starts, but results suck probably ? :)

Time: 05:21.48 , for that usual test.blend script. Version of blender are latest from os4depot - 248.7. Tested on 32bit screen, 1440x900 if that make any difference.

Strange anyway, i checked their page , and found for example that:

3635 00:04:59.84 1x Intel® Pentium® 4 3000MHz 3000MHz 2 2048MB WinXP Pro 2.49 test.blend

How it can be, that its about as pentium4 3ghz ?

From other side, found that:

513 00:00:30.69 1x Intel® Xeon® X5355 2660MHz 2660MHz 4 4096MB WinVista 64Bit 2.43 SSE2 test.blend

How it can be such a bit differences betwen those 2 ?

@kas1e

Your X5000 is faster than my X1000. Also remember to compare only the exact versions of Blender. Blender v2.49 is 3 times faster than v2.48 on my (1.8GHz Core2Duo) Mac with the same test.blend. Also could you overclock your X5000 to 3GHz, or you have to compensate the numbers, to make better comparison ? Also the CPU's L2 and L3 cache sizes matters. Special compilations of the software to particular CPU models instead of generic CPU machine code matters as well. Somehow I doubt the info in your 2nd PC quote.
